Pompeii is important to archaeologists and historians because it provides a remarkably well-preserved snapshot of daily life in a Roman town, frozen in time by the eruption of Mount Vesuvius in 79 AD. The ruins offer valuable insights into Roman architecture, urban planning, art, and culture, allowing scholars to study the past in unprecedented detail. Pompeii's excavation has revolutionized our understanding of ancient civilizations and continues to yield new discoveries.
